MY BOOKING REWARDS LAUNCHES CARIBBEAN INCENTIVES
Online incentives and rewards provider My Booking Rewards has launched a Caribbean Travel Guru Rewards Programme in partnership with Travel Uni. The introduction of the programme means agents
can earn rewards every time they make a booking anywhere in the Caribbean and upload the details. The programme went live earlier this month and 463 bookings details have already been uploaded, representing more than £3 million in revenue by more than 100 newly joined agents. Agents also have the opportunity to double or
treble their rewards. For example, if an agent books a holiday to Jewel Resorts in Jamaica, they will receive a reward from the hotel, the tourist board and the Caribbean Tourism Organization. AGENTS SET FOR MARATHON FAM TRIP TO CAYMAN ISLANDS
The Cayman Islands Department of Tourism has picked two agents to embark on a marathon fam trip. Yvette Bailey,
from Thomson in Portsmouth, and Emma McIntyre,
of Co-operative Personal Travel Advisors in Berkshire, will be running the Cayman Islands half or full marathon on December 7.
Meanwhile, Debbie Muir, from If Only Holidays, and Sarah Tetik, of
Dreamtime Travel, both won Love2shop vouchers in a prize draw following the launch of the destination’s new training course. Rathi Sivasothy, of Flight Centre in London, and Suzanne Smith, of Hays Travel, Norfolk, won trolley bags in the same draw.
